What the numbers show
Average age of workers in the industrial sector, aged 15-64, rural is currently reported for 85 countries. The highest value is 46.41 in Denmark; the lowest is 29.23 in Cambodia.
The median across all reporting countries is 37.94, and the mean is 38.09.
The gap between the highest and lowest reporting country is a factor of about 2.
Over the past decade 70 countries rose and 15 fell. The largest increase was in Ireland (up 15.4%), and the largest decrease in Ukraine (down 7.4%).
